What is MEMM?
MEMM is a development project that supports the education and inclusion of children and young people with diverse language and cultural backgrounds in Icelandic schools and after-school programs.
The project is carried out in close cooperation with municipalities, schools, and professionals all over Iceland. Its goal is to develop effective ways to welcome, teach, and support students from different linguistic and cultural backgrounds.
MEMM is led by the Ministry of Education and Children, and the project coordinator is Fríða B. Jónsdóttir.
As part of the project, the Language and Literacy Centre, a specialist team focusing on language and literacy for preschool and compulsory school children, has become part of the Directorate of Education and School Services. The Directorate has also increased the number of teaching consultants and bridge-builders, and a MEMM team for upper secondary schools is now active.
